Наложение растра ggR на ggRGB - PullRequest
0 голосов
/ 28 июня 2018

Я пытаюсь наложить растр с помощью ggR на RGB, нанесенный с помощью ggRGB. Части растра ggR имеют значения NA (или это также могут быть нули), которые должны быть прозрачными и отображать базовый растр RGB. Любая помощь о том, как этого добиться?

library(RStoolbox)
library(tidyverse)

data(rlogo)
im <- rlogo[[1]]
im[im>100]=NA
im[im<=100]=1
ggRGB(rlogo, r=1, g=2, b=3)+ggR(im,ggLayer=T,geom_raster=T)+ 
scale_fill_gradientn(colours=rainbow(1),na.value="transparent")

enter image description here

...